I really need help it tells me i have a virus & I need to use the boot option so i do that. Then when i do that it auto scans .A virus is detected so I hit repair a error message appears Error 42060 then i hit repair all same Error message appears 42060. Someone please help me on what i do next. Do i delete or delete all or what. I dont wanna pick the wrong optiion thankyou someone.

42060 AVAST_REPAIR_NOTREPAIRED File was not repaired
Only true virus infected files can be repaired, the others just need to be deleted.
But before doing so, tell us what files are infected, what are their locations and with what are they infected?
